How the Calculation Works

Lease Liability = SUM( Payment / (1 + r)n )
Where: r = periodic discount rate, n = period number

Identify Lease Payments

Include fixed payments, in-substance fixed payments, and amounts expected to be payable under residual value guarantees.

Determine Discount Rate

Use the interest rate implicit in the lease if determinable. Otherwise, use the lessee's incremental borrowing rate.

Calculate Present Value

Discount each future lease payment to present value. The sum of these present values equals the initial lease liability.

Measure ROU Asset

Start with the lease liability, add initial direct costs and prepaid payments, then deduct any lease incentives received.
